Goats for the apprentice

Sako .222 hogging the limelight and Wilson in the background looking pleased.

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

Took the pup out for a day, and we got some curry/stew and dog bones packages for the freezer.  The Sako has gone through a 40 year relationship with the Leupold 1-4 scope atop it.  It finally gave up the ghost last year and Leupold came to the party immediately and provided me with a brand new VX3 1-5 free of charge, otherwise apart from the Mcmillan stock the barreled action has been there done that in the North and South Island, pro shooting in both.  Barnes bullets are the projectiles of choice and I am using 45 grn at the moment in TSX.  Anyway a new era is dawning, with the canine.
